TMA unveils new logo and aircraft design

Trans Maldivian Airways (TMA) has unveiled its new logo and aircraft design.

This comes as part of the celebrations to mark one year since majority shares in the two companies, TMA and Maldives Air Taxi (MAT), were acquired by New York’s Blackstone Group.

The two companies, since the merger in February 2013, have been called Trans Maldivian Airways (TMA).

The ceremony to celebrate the one year anniversary was held at Ibrahim Nasir International Airport today.

Speaking at the ceremony, CEO of TMA A.U.M. Fauzy said that the company has seen great progress since the two companies merged, and that efforts will be made to expand its services in the future.
